In Singapore, commuters and shoppers will be able to take their pets with them and even get $2 off the booking fee for the rest of the year!

The rates for this new service will begin on October 20, 2017. The service is being called UberPET. Depending on the driver, you can bring your dog, cat, turtle, rabbit, hamster, a bird in a cage, or a fish in a bowl or plastic bag! The only rule issued by Uber that pet be accompanied by a rider. The driver gets to decide if more than one pet will be allowed to ride at one time. Uber does request that all pets be on a leash or in a carrier for safety.

The rider is going to be held responsible for the animal and its behavior. There is no plan to have any insurance coverage for the animals on the service. The rider is also responsible for any damage done to the vehicle during the ride, but little things like slobber on the window or shedding will not result in additional charges.
